DEPT® took home the trophy for Best Agency Culture at the UK Business Tech Awards 2021. 

The UK-wide awards celebrate the nation’s finest tech businesses, rewarding the innovative companies whose exceptional application of technology is transforming businesses and shaping the future. This latest triumph follows DEPT® being crowned Large Digital Agency of the Year at the Prolific North Champions Awards and a triple win at the Optimizely Partner Awards as Optimizer of the Year.

Aspiring to be the best agency in and for the world, DEPT® has built its culture on strong inclusive values, nurturing the best talent and by creating inspiring environments for individuals to thrive. 

Brian Robinson, UK Managing Director of DEPT®, said: “Winning this award serves as incredible recognition of DEPT®’s commitment to being a people-first business. Depsters play an integral role in us becoming the best agency in and for the world. Without our people, we cannot make the positive difference that we aim for. The last 18 months have been challenging for us all and I’m incredibly proud of our team.”

In response to the pandemic, DEPT® accelerated its efforts to help boost health and happiness and promote positive work-life balance. This included establishing dedicated wellbeing advisors to support Depsters with their mental health, creating next-level virtual events for our teams across the world, subsidised WFH equipment, and launching an internal awards scheme to celebrate Depsters’ achievements. We’ve also implemented a diversity and inclusion calendar to celebrate events and festivals, and encouraged Depsters to take part in wellness and sustainability challenges. Our DE&I team also ensures that internal practices and behaviours align with continual societal changes.

Support for Depsters will continue to evolve to ensure we are creating the best conditions for our people, clients and the planet.
